There are high hopes for a good season of basking shark sightings off the coast of the Isle of Man this year.Since 2010, basking shark numbers are said to have decreased dramatically in Manx waters - from around 500 sighting reports per season in 2010 to just 10 last year.But Manx Whale and Dolphin Watch says it's already had six reported to it since the end of April.Jen Adams from the charity has been telling Amy Griffiths more:
